Perhaps it has occured to you that we could tap Earth's magnetic field to generate energy. One way to do this would be to spin a metal loop about an axis perpendicular to Earth's magnetic field. Suppose that the metal loop is a square that is 45 cm on each side and that we want to generate an electric potential in the loop of amplitude 120 V ata a place where earths magnetic field is 0.5x10^-4. At what angulare speed (in rev/s) would we ahve to spin the coil? Does this appear to be a feasible method to extract energy from earths magnetic field?

Explanation / Answer

Area

A=L^2= 0.45^2 =0.2025 m^2

Maximum induced emf

Emax=NBAW

W=Emax/NBA

W=120/1*(0.5*10^-4)*0.2025

W=11,851,851.85 rad/s

in rev/s

W=11851851.85/2pi

W=1,886.280.8 rev/s
